Forumi


Povratak   PC Ekspert Forum > Računala > Software > Web dizajn, programiranje i ostalo
Ime
Lozinka

Odgovori
 
Uređivanje
Staro 01.04.2022., 09:03   #1
spiderhr
Premium
 
Datum registracije: Jul 2021
Lokacija: Sesvete
Postovi: 726
Docker + Portainer

Nisam našao temu, ako sam slučajno fulao brišite.

Kaj hostate u Dockeru sve?

Pratim LowAndTalk pa tamo našao temu.

Počeo sam se igrati sa dockerom i portainerom, do sada sam kad mi nekaj trebalo dizao appove zasebno.

Trenutno mi u planu da podignem
  • docker
  • portainer
  • nginx proxy manager
  • mariadb
  • nextcloud
  • phpmyadmin
Zanima me kaj Vi ostali koristite.
spiderhr je offline   Reply With Quote
Staro 01.04.2022., 10:26   #2
xlr
49%winner
Moj komp
 
xlr's Avatar
 
Datum registracije: Sep 2007
Lokacija: PU
Postovi: 9,288
Ono sto se vrti konstantno je:

NPM i mariadb
Vaultwarden + fail2ban
Mealie
Calibre
Uptime kuma
Watchtower
Cloudflare DDNS

Mimo toga, trenutno guglam kako upogoniti Pihole+Unbound kontejnere uz Keepalived i koristenje floating IP-a. Trenutno takav setup koristim kao bare metal instalaciju na 2 RPI-ja, ali bih volio preci na kontejnere radi jednostavnosti i eliminiranja ekstra hardvera.

Takodjer u planu je upogoniti neki dashboard app tipa Homer ili Heimdall, te naravno Autheliu. To odgadjam valjda vec pola godine... Isto vrijedi i za Teleport kojeg sam bii slozio, skoro pa uspio i na kraju iz nekog razloga digo ruke.

Plex sam nekada vrtio na Shield tvu pa se jedno vrijeme vrtio i u kontejneru i radio je odlicno. Sad je na NAS-u.

Tu i tamo zavrtim i malo testiram neke od sljedecih appova, cisto da provjerim sto je novo (ako je izasao kakav update):
Photoprism
Photonix
Airsonic

Nekad se pitam jesam li trebao pola vremena koje sam ulozio u Docker uloziti u Proxmox. Da nisam prije godinu dana krenuo s Raspberryjem, nego npr nekim kompom, vjerojatno bi krenuo u suprotnom smjeru.
__________________
Keep calm and fastboot oem unlock.
xlr je offline   Reply With Quote
Oglasni prostor
Oglas
 
Oglas
Staro 24.01.2023., 11:57   #3
spiderhr
Premium
 
Datum registracije: Jul 2021
Lokacija: Sesvete
Postovi: 726
Ima li kakav template za Portainer za AdGuard?

Trenutno testiram PiHole kojeg sam instalirao uspješno sa ovim templateom


Code:
version: "3"

# More info at https://github.com/pi-hole/docker-pi-hole/ and https://docs.pi-hole.net/
services:
  pihole:
    container_name: pihole
    image: pihole/pihole:latest
    # For DHCP it is recommended to remove these ports and instead add: network_mode: "host"
    ports:
      - "53:53/tcp"
      - "53:53/udp"
      - "67:67/udp" # Only required if you are using Pi-hole as your DHCP server
      - "1080:80/tcp"
    environment:
      TZ: 'Europe/zagreb'
      WEBPASSWORD: 'osobno11'
    # Volumes store your data between container upgrades
    volumes:
      - './etc-pihole:/etc/pihole'
      - './etc-dnsmasq.d:/etc/dnsmasq.d'
    #   https://github.com/pi-hole/docker-pi-hole#note-on-capabilities
    cap_add:
      - NET_ADMIN # Required if you are using Pi-hole as your DHCP server, else not needed
    restart: unless-stopped
spiderhr je offline   Reply With Quote
Staro 24.01.2023., 12:19   #4
Cuky
jedan i jedini :D
Moj komp
 
Cuky's Avatar
 
Datum registracije: Sep 2005
Lokacija: novi zagreb
Postovi: 5,051
Sta nema negdje nesto sluzbeno objavljeno? Ili na githubu? Jesi provjerio gore?
Cuky je online   Reply With Quote
Staro 24.01.2023., 12:25   #5
xlr
49%winner
Moj komp
 
xlr's Avatar
 
Datum registracije: Sep 2007
Lokacija: PU
Postovi: 9,288
Ima na docker hubu run komanda:
https://hub.docker.com/r/adguard/adguardhome

Mozes je pretvoriti u yaml na:
https://www.composerize.com/
__________________
Keep calm and fastboot oem unlock.
xlr je offline   Reply With Quote
Staro 24.01.2023., 14:39   #6
spiderhr
Premium
 
Datum registracije: Jul 2021
Lokacija: Sesvete
Postovi: 726
Citiraj:
Autor xlr Pregled postova
Ima na docker hubu run komanda:
https://hub.docker.com/r/adguard/adguardhome

Mozes je pretvoriti u yaml na:
https://www.composerize.com/

Probao i baš ne radi...

Uf... još učenje dockera. Lakše je virtualku instalirat samo kaj da imaš sve virtualke treba resursa.
spiderhr je offline   Reply With Quote
Staro 24.01.2023., 15:05   #7
xlr
49%winner
Moj komp
 
xlr's Avatar
 
Datum registracije: Sep 2007
Lokacija: PU
Postovi: 9,288
Aaa jos si tu. Je da, docker yaml zna biti hit n miss dosta puta dok ne uspijes dobiti sto zelis. Ovo sam dobio od kolege pa mozda pomogne. Zanemari kompletan "labels" dio, to je za setup proxy managera. Takodjer, mozda ces i dio o mrezi promjeniti na nesto primitivnije od macvlan-a (dio o mrezama savjetujem prouciti i nauciti, vrlo korisno na duze staze). Ja nisam osobno nikad slagao adguard pa ne mogu puno pomoci.

Baci oko i na ovaj sajt, meni je super doslo nakon sto sam savladao neke osnove da malo sredim i (kompliciranije) setupove:
https://www.smarthomebeginner.com/

Code:
version: "3"
########################### NETWORKS
networks:
  macvlan_network:
    driver: macvlan
    driver_opts:
      parent: eth0
    ipam: 
      config: 
        - subnet: 192.168.2.0/24
          gateway: 192.168.2.1
          ip_range: 192.168.2.20/29
  # t2_proxy:
  #   external:
  #     name: t2_proxy

########################### SERVICE
services:
  # AdGuard
  adguard:
    container_name: adguard
    image: adguard/adguardhome
    restart: unless-stopped
    privileged: true
    # network_mode: host

    networks:
      macvlan_network:
        ipv4_address: 192.168.2.21
      # t2_proxy:

    # security_opt:
    #   - no-new-privileges:true
    ports:
      # host:container ports
      - "53:53/tcp"
      - "53:53/udp"
      - "67:67/udp"
      - "80:80/tcp"
      - "443:443/tcp"
      - "853:853/tcp"
      - "853:853/udp"
      - "784:784/tcp"
      - "3000:3000/tcp"
    volumes:
      - $DOCKERDIR/adguard/work:/opt/adguardhome/work
      - $DOCKERDIR/adguard/conf:/opt/adguardhome/conf
      - $DOCKERDIR/traefik2/acme:/opt/certs
    environment:
      - TZ=$TZ
      - PUID=$PUID
      - PGID=$PGID
    labels:
      - "traefik.enable=true"
      - "traefik.http.routers.adguard-home.rule=Host(`adguard.$DOMAINNAME`)"
      - "traefik.http.routers.adguard-home.entrypoints=https"
      - "traefik.http.routers.adguard-home.tls=true"
      - "traefik.http.routers.adguard-home.middlewares=chain-oauth@file" # Google OAuth 2.0
      # - "traefik.http.services.adguard-home.loadbalancer.server.url=https://192.168.2.21:3000"
      # - "traefik.http.services.adguard-home.loadbalancer.server.path=192.168.2.21"
      - "traefik.http.services.adguard-home.loadbalancer.server.scheme=http"
      # - "traefik.http.services.adguard-home.loadbalancer.server.port=443"
      - "traefik.http.services.adguard-home.loadbalancer.server.port=3000"
__________________
Keep calm and fastboot oem unlock.
xlr je offline   Reply With Quote
Staro 24.01.2023., 15:11   #8
spiderhr
Premium
 
Datum registracije: Jul 2021
Lokacija: Sesvete
Postovi: 726
Da tu sam. Mislim da bum prvo ipak bacio virtualku s adguardom... Čisto da vidim kako radi on pa ću se kasnije zabaviti sa dockerom.


Hvala
spiderhr je offline   Reply With Quote
Oglasni prostor
Oglas
 
Oglas
Odgovori


Uređivanje

Pravila postanja
Vi ne možete otvarati nove teme
Vi ne možete pisati odgovore
Vi ne možete uploadati priloge
Vi ne možete uređivati svoje poruke

BB code je Uključeno
Smajlići su Uključeno
[IMG] kod je Uključeno
HTML je Isključeno

Idi na